如何服务器查看svn提交记录
-
要查看服务器上的SVN提交记录,可以通过以下步骤进行:
-
连接到SVN服务器:首先,你需要使用SVN客户端工具(如TortoiseSVN、Subversion)连接到SVN服务器。打开SVN客户端工具,然后选择连接选项,输入服务器的URL和登录凭据(用户名和密码),点击连接按钮。
-
导航到仓库:连接成功后,你将看到SVN服务器上的仓库列表。选择你想要查看提交记录的仓库,然后双击进入。
-
查看提交历史:进入仓库后,你将看到仓库下的目录和文件列表。右键点击你要查看提交记录的文件或目录,选择“查看提交历史”选项。
-
查看提交记录:点击“查看提交历史”后,你将看到一个列表,显示了该文件或目录的所有提交记录。每个提交记录都包含了提交的版本号、作者、提交日期和提交注释等信息。
-
过滤和排序提交:在提交历史列表上,你可以使用工具提供的过滤和排序选项来筛选和排序提交记录。例如,你可以根据作者、日期范围或提交注释关键词等进行过滤,或按照版本号、提交日期等进行排序。
-
查看具体提交变更:要查看某个提交记录具体的变更内容,可以双击该记录或选择该记录并点击“显示变更”按钮。这样,你将看到该次提交所做的具体文件的变更,包括添加、删除、修改的文件以及其相关的注释。
以上就是在服务器上查看SVN提交记录的步骤。通过这种方式,你可以方便地追踪和了解提交历史,查看每个版本的变更内容,并与团队成员共享和讨论。
1年前 -
-
要查看SVN提交记录,您可以使用不同的方法和工具。下面是一些常见的方法:
-
使用命令行工具:
- 首先,您需要在服务器上安装并配置SVN。
- 然后,在终端或命令提示符下,使用"svn log"命令来查看提交记录。
- 您可以通过一系列选项来自定义查询,例如“svn log -r <版本号>”将显示特定版本的提交记录。“svn log -l <数字>”将显示最近的指定数量的提交记录。
-
使用图形界面工具:
- 有多种图形界面工具可供选择,例如TortoiseSVN,RapidSVN等。
- 安装并配置您选择的工具。
- 打开工具,选择要查看提交记录的SVN存储库。
- 在工具的界面中,您通常会找到一个“日志”或“提交历史”选项,点击它将显示提交记录。
-
使用SVN Web界面:
- 如果您的SVN服务器配置了Web访问界面,您可以使用Web浏览器来查看提交记录。
- 在浏览器地址栏中输入SVN服务器的URL。
- 登录到SVN Web界面。
- 导航到提交记录或类似的选项,通常可以在页面上找到一个链接或按钮以查看提交记录。
-
使用SVN客户端工具:
- 有一些第三方的SVN客户端工具,如SmartSVN,Cornerstone等,它们提供了更丰富的功能和更友好的界面。
- 您可以安装并配置这些工具。
- 打开工具,并连接到您的SVN存储库。
- 在工具的界面中,通常会有一个“提交历史”或类似的选项,点击它将显示提交记录。
-
使用SVN Hooks:
- 如果您想要更高级的提交记录跟踪和自定义功能,您可以编写和配置SVN Hook脚本。
- SVN Hooks是一种自定义脚本,可以在特定的SVN操作发生时触发,例如提交。
- 您可以编写一个Hook脚本来捕获提交记录并将它们记录到文件或数据库中,以供稍后查看。
以上是几种常见的方法,用于在服务器上查看SVN提交记录。您可以根据自己的喜好和需求选择最适合您的方法。
1年前 -
-
要在服务器上查看SVN提交记录,可以按照以下步骤进行操作:
-
安装SVN服务器:首先确保你的服务器上已经安装了SVN服务器。可以选择通过package manager(如apt或yum)安装最新稳定版本的SVN,或者前往官方网站(https://subversion.apache.org/packages.html)下载适合你服务器操作系统的最新版本。
-
创建SVN仓库:在服务器上创建一个SVN仓库,用于存储你的代码和提交记录。使用SVN命令行工具(svnadmin)创建一个新的仓库。例如,使用以下命令创建一个名为"myrepo"的仓库:
svnadmin create /path/to/myrepo -
配置权限和用户访问控制:在SVN仓库中配置权限和用户访问控制,以确保只有授权的用户可以查看提交记录。在仓库的conf目录下编辑以下文件:
- authz:配置用户访问权限,可以设置哪些用户组可以访问仓库。
- passwd:配置用户和密码,以便用户可以使用用户名和密码进行认证。
-
启动SVN服务器:使用以下命令启动SVN服务器,使其可以接受来自客户端的连接:
svnserve -d -r /path/to/myrepo这将启动一个SVN服务器进程,并监听3690端口。
-
在本地使用SVN客户端:为了查看提交记录,你需要在你的本地计算机上安装SVN客户端。你可以使用命令行工具,如svn命令,或者使用图形化的SVN客户端,如TortoiseSVN。
-
连接到SVN服务器:使用SVN客户端连接到服务器,检出(checkout)仓库到你本地计算机上。使用SVN命令:
svn checkout svn://yourserver/path/to/myrepo这将在当前目录下创建一个名为myrepo的目录,并将服务器上的仓库检出到该目录。
-
查看提交记录:进入仓库目录,可以使用以下命令查看提交记录:
svn log这将显示包括每个提交的详细信息,例如提交的版本号,日期,提交者和提交的注释。
以上就是在服务器上查看SVN提交记录的方法和操作流程。通过这些步骤,你可以在服务器上配置SVN和权限,并使用SVN客户端查看提交记录。
1年前 -